Challenges in Data Standardization

Challenges in Data Standardization

Data standardization is a critical step in the ETL (Extract, Transform, Load) process, yet it presents several challenges that organizations must address to ensure data quality and consistency.

  1. Data Source Heterogeneity: Different data sources often have varying formats, structures, and quality levels, making it difficult to standardize data.
  2. Data Volume and Velocity: Handling large volumes of data in real-time or near-real-time requires robust infrastructure and efficient algorithms for standardization.
  3. Data Governance: Ensuring compliance with data governance policies and regulations can complicate the standardization process, requiring additional checks and balances.
  4. Integration Complexity: Integrating disparate systems and applications often involves complex transformations and mappings, which can be streamlined using tools like ApiX-Drive.
  5. Resource Constraints: Limited technical expertise and budget can hinder the implementation of effective data standardization strategies.

Techniques for Data Standardization

Techniques for Data Standardization

Data standardization is a crucial step in the ETL (Extract, Transform, Load) process, ensuring that data from various sources is consistent and comparable. This process involves converting data into a common format, which helps in improving data quality and making it easier to analyze.

There are several techniques for data standardization that organizations can employ. These techniques help in dealing with different data formats, units, and structures, thus enabling seamless integration and analysis.

  • Data Mapping: Aligning data fields from different sources to a standardized schema.
  • Data Transformation: Converting data into a common format or structure.
  • Data Cleansing: Removing duplicates and correcting errors.
  • Data Enrichment: Enhancing data by adding additional information from external sources.

FAQ

What is data standardization in the context of ETL?

Data standardization in the context of ETL (Extract, Transform, Load) refers to the process of converting data into a common format to ensure consistency and compatibility across different data sources. This involves transforming data into a standardized structure and format before loading it into a target system or database.

Why is data standardization important for ETL processes?

Data standardization is crucial for ETL processes because it ensures that data from different sources can be easily integrated and analyzed. It helps in maintaining data quality, reduces errors, and makes it easier to perform data analysis and reporting. Standardized data also facilitates better decision-making and improves overall data governance.

What are the common challenges in data standardization for ETL?

Common challenges in data standardization for ETL include dealing with inconsistent data formats, handling missing or incomplete data, and managing data from multiple sources with different structures. Additionally, ensuring data accuracy and integrity during the transformation process can be complex and time-consuming.
